In a statement to Kohler before he took to the Senate floor, Marshall said Mayorkas had lied under oath to Congress several times and said Mayorkas did not have “operational control” of the U.S. border. Marshall added that the Secretary of Homeland Security must be held accountable for his inaction on the ongoing border crisis.
“Secretary Mayorkas has repeatedly lied under oath to Congress, testifying that his DHS has “operational control'' of the border. All Americans can see for themselves that this statement by Mayorkas is categorically false and completely delusional,” Marshall told the Caller. Marshall plans to introduce the resolution late Tuesday night and hopes it will pass unanimously.
Republicans have already begun impeachment proceedings against Mayorkas in the House of Representatives, with proceedings scheduled to begin on Wednesday. He has long been a target of Republican criticism as border crossers and illegal immigration arrests hit record highs under the Biden administration.
